Hello Satoshi,

There's a lot of stuff here that might prove the claim, but I'm wondering (and maybe this is a gap in my knowledge) why you didn't just sign a message with your keys? It seems easier, and if you have Kleopatra it's not hard to do.

You can then copy it out and put it inline in the email, like this below:

Now, I'm some nobody from New Hampshire, so people on this list might not have my public key to verify the above signature, but if I were more popular they could get it from a key-server somewhere, or from a previous email I sent, or from erikgranger.name, and though it doesn't prove that I'm Erik Granger, it proves I have that key, which is neat.
I'm not saying the proof you provided is invalid, Mr. Nakamoto, but I am curious why you wouldn't just do it the boring way?
